The initial table shows the all a number of the analytes and test conditions used in Shelf Life studies for tobacco products for one testing condition at one timepoint and one replicate.

Row 1: | Shows the LBTEST of Product Moisture which reflects the percentage of moisture in the substance for the condition noted in LBTSTCND which is Condition 1 (X°C/ Z% RH). Product Moisture is sometimes referred to as "Oven Volatiles". | Rows 2-12: | Show the analytes used in testing. | |

The shelf life A Shelf Life study dataset would shows analytes done over in different test conditions with replicates over time points. In the interest of brevity in an for this example, this only shows the moistureonly Product Moisture (also known as Oven Volatile) percentage is shown in a sample of timepoints in two conditions with replicates.

Rows 1-9: | Show the LBTEST of Product Moisture for Condition 1 (X°C/ Z% RH) which is shown in LBTSTCND. The sample of various timepoints that may be used in the testing for product moisture is reflected in LBTPT. The LBTPTNUM shows the numerical version of the planned timepoint. The REPNUM shows the incidence number of a test that is repeated within a given timeframe for the same test. | Rows 10-18: | Show the LBTEST of Product Moisture for Condition 2 Condition 2 (A °C/ B %RH) across the same timepoints shown for Condition 1. The LBGRPID is used to tie together a block of related records in a single domain. | |
